AC Power Requirements
This chapter describes the AC power requirements for the Oracle MICROS hardware.
MICROS workstations are based on highly sophisticated hardware components that
are designed to provide efficient and trouble-free operation.
Proper installation of the AC power and grounding system is essential to minimize the
possibility of interference and enhances the performance and reliability of the
hardware.

Preferred AC Power System
All power conductors and equipment grounding conductors must be isolated from
other power circuits in the facility to ensure that electrical noise produced by other
equipment does not create interference for the system hardware.
To accomplish this, install a power distribution panel intended for the sole use of the
MICROS hardware. Do not use this dedicated panel to supply other electrical loads in
the facility. Run the panel’s feeder supply directly from the main source panel for the
facility.
